Yes, definitely. Your personal feelings don't come into it, as mine don't when I'm arresting these people.

I have dealt with several drink drivers, some of whom were very nice people who made a silly mistake. Others were serial offenders who should be locked up for their own and everyone else's safety. However, my feelings were irrelevant. The safety of others was the driving factor when I dealt with these people.

Whether you love him or loathe him, you should report him if he is driving drunk. Not "if he is likely to get into his car", that's not illegal or wrong, but if he does do it or try to do it. Be sure of your facts and your evidence, e.g. staggering all over the place, driving erratically etc., and if that's so the police will accept a 999 call as it is emphatically urgent to stop him before he kills someone.
